果胶酶辅助提取裙带菜孢子叶多糖的工艺条件优化  被引量:12

Optimization on pectase-assistant extracting technological conditions of polysaccharide from sporophyll of Undaria pinnatifida by response surface methodology

摘  要:为优化裙带菜孢子叶多糖的提取工艺,利用响应面中的Box-Behnken设计优化果胶酶辅助提取裙带菜孢子叶多糖的工艺条件。以多糖得率为评价指标,最终确定果胶酶辅助提取裙带菜孢子叶多糖工艺条件为酶加量0.65%、液料比59∶1(V∶m),pH值3.4。该条件下,裙带菜孢子叶多糖得率为4.79%。To optimize the extracting technology of polysaccharide from sporophyll of Undaria pinnatifida,the technological condition of pectase-assistant extracting polysaccharide from sporophyll of Undaria pinnatifida was optimized by response surface methodology(RSM).Polysaccharide extraction yield was as evaluated index and final optimal technological conditions of pectase-assistant extracting polysaccharide were as follows: the amount of pectase was 0.65%,the ratio of water and material was 59:1(V∶m) and pH was 3.4,respectively.At this condition,polysaccharide extracting yield from sporophyll of Undaria pinnatifida was 4.79%.
